Adventist Health Care Home Health seeks to hire a Certified Occupational Therapist Assistant (COTA) in our Silver Spring Territory servicing Lower Montgomery County who will embrace our mission to extend God’s care through the ministry of physical, mental and spiritual healing.
The Certified Occupational Therapist Assistant (COTA) will work under the supervision of the Occupational Therapist and assist them to provide rehabilitative services to patients to recover, improve, and maintain the skills needed for day-to-day activities.
